Abstract

Tool for driving fastening elements into a hard receiving material, such as concrete, masonry, rock and the like, has a first device (1) for drilling a fastening element into the hard material and a second device (2) for axially propelling the fastening element into the receiving material after it has been partly drilled in. The first device (1) provides a borehole in the hard receiving material by applying rotary movement to the fastening element, possibly with the addition of axially directed striking force. The second device (2) completes the insertion of the fastening element into the receiving material by directing an axial force produced by high pressure gases against the partly drilled in fastening element.
